摘要:
Highly porous graphite matrices with 20-200 kg m(-3) of bulk densities have been characterized using helium pycnometer, mercury porosimeter, and fluid flow methods, i.e. both gas permeation and diffusion measurements. The gas permeability is ranging from 10(-12) to 10(-15) m(2) and decreases as the bulk density of the graphite matrix increases. According to the Carman-Kozeny correlation, the evolution of the gas permeability with respect to the bulk density is very well correlate with, on the one hand, the increase of the tortuosity, and on the other hand, the decrease of the porosity as well as the pore diameter with the bulk density of the graphite matrix.
